Archivo para la categoría Java

Java – Archivos JAR bloqueados por URLClassLoader en Windows

Un archivo JAR es un contenedor comprimido de clases y recursos asociados, útil para la distribución de aplicaciones, librerías o módulos.  En arquitecturas de tipo modular es común utilizar diferentes cargadores de clases para poder cargar, re-cargar y descargar módulos en forma dinámica y en tiempo de ejecución sin tener que reiniciar la JVM.

Leer el resto de esta entrada »

, , , , , , , ,

2 comentarios

Java – Proyecto Coin (JSR 334) – Cambios en el lenguaje para aumentar la productividad

Uno de los cuatro JSRs (Java Especification Requests) que se incluyen en el nuevo JDK 7 es el JSR 334, conocido también como el Proyecto Coin.

Esta propuesta, titulada como “Small Enhancements to the JavaTM Programming Language” (en español: pequeñas mejoras en el lenguaje de programación JavaTM), es sucesora del antiguo JSR 201 (incluido en el JDK 5) el cual fue responsable de notables extensiones en el lenguaje Java al introducir Enumeraciones, Autoboxing, un bucle for mejorado (llamado también: “for each”) e importaciones estáticas, todas estas muy bien recordadas y agradecidas hasta el día de hoy.

Leer el resto de esta entrada »

, , , , , , , , ,

Deja un comentario

Java 7 – Versión final

El pasado día 7 del mes 7 de 2011 y después de casi 5 años desde la aparición del JDK 6, Oracle presentaba oficialmente el JDK 7 y dejaba disponible la descarga de la versión RC (Release Candidate). En este importante evento participaron organizaciones como IBM, Eclipse Foundation, etc. y también tuvieron la palabra los representantes de algunos JUG (Java User Groups). Se puede ver la retransmisión Webcast de este evento en el sitio web de Oracle, aquí el enlace.

En la fecha de hoy, 28/7/11, la versión final GA (General Acceptance) del JDK 7 ah sido publicada y esta lista para descargar. Las versiones disponibles son para Windows, Linux y Solaris. En el caso de Mac OS X tardará un poco más.   Leer el resto de esta entrada »

, , , , , ,

Deja un comentario

Java – TextPad Demo


Leer el resto de esta entrada »

, , , ,

1 comentario

Java – Crear un editor de texto

En este tutorial crearemos un editor básico multi-plataforma para documentos de texto plano. Se llamará TextPad Demo y se utilizará la biblioteca gráfica Swing por ser la biblioteca predeterminada en Java, además de flexible y portable. En el desarrollo puede sernos de utilidad un IDE para facilitarnos algunas tareas, pero en la creación de la interface gráfica de usuario (GUI) no se utilizará el editor gráfico, todo el código se escribirá directamente a mano ya sea en el IDE o en el editor de preferencia.

Leer el resto de esta entrada »

, , ,

4 comentarios

Java – ROT13

Hola Mundo
Ubyn Zhaqb
Hola Mundo

Leer el resto de esta entrada »

,

Deja un comentario

Criptografía – ROT13

ROT13 es un método criptográfico clásico basado en el cifrado por sustitución, de su nombre se entiende “rotar 13 posiciones”. Este consiste en el desplazamiento de las letras del alfabeto latino, es decir se altera el orden, lo cual se logra sustituyendo sucesivamente cada letra por la letra que se encuentra 13 posiciones más adelante en el alfabeto.

Leer el resto de esta entrada »

, , , , , , , ,

Deja un comentario

Java SE 6 – Update 26


Oracle ha publicado el 7 de Junio de 2011 la actualización número 26 de la versión 6 de Java: SE 6.0 – Update 25 (Nombre interno: 1.6.0_26-b03).

Esta disponible en Windows, Linux y Solaris. Los usuarios de Mac OS X deberán de esperar la actualización por parte de Apple, ya que Oracle no es el proveedor de Java para esa plataforma.

Leer el resto de esta entrada »

, , , ,

Deja un comentario

Ant – Integración con IDE Eclipse

Ant, la popular herramienta de construcción de proyectos desarrollada por la Apache Software Foundation, esta nativamente integrada en el IDE Eclipse como plug-in. Esto nos puede permitir un cómodo desarrollo ya que podemos añadirle a nuestros proyectos scripts programados para Ant y hacer que funcionen como un constructor de proyecto realizando tareas como el empaquetamiento de archivos compilados en tarros (.jar), generar la documentación de código fuente, actualización de otros proyectos que necesitan estar en sincronía, etc. Podemos ordenar la ejecución de estos scripts manualmente o en forma automática junto a eventos del IDE, en si lo importante es decir que podemos usar Ant desde el interior del propio IDE. Leer el resto de esta entrada »

, , , , , , , , , , ,

4 comentarios

Java ME SDK 3.0 – Problema en el inicio: java.net.ConnectException

Para todos aquellos que estén experimentando un problema en el inicio del entorno de desarrollo del SDK recibiendo una java.net.Exception como se ve en la siguiente imagen:

Esto se debe a estar usando una versión de Windows de 64-bit y haber instalado el Java ME SDK 3.0 con un JDK de 64-bit (x64). Para solucionar este problema no necesitamos reinstalar nada, simplemente seguir estos pasos:

Leer el resto de esta entrada »

, , , , , , ,

3 comentarios